President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o is addressing the United Nations General Assembly at its 74th meeting in New York, in areas of education, protection of human rights and health among other things.
It is expected that Nana Addo will extol the benefits and progress of his Free Senior High School education policy in Ghana and the strides his government has made in the areas of Human Rights as well as Health.
The President, who is also a Co-Chair of the group of Eminent Leaders on the UN Sustainable Development Goals, is also expected to give an account of the group’s work so far towards the achievement of the SDGs.
The United Nations General Assembly kicked off on Tuesday in New York with world leaders and diplomats from 193 nations coming together to try and address a range of pressing issues.
